Melanie Woodin is the 17th President of the University of Toronto, appointed in July 2025. An internationally recognized neuroscientist studying the mechanisms of learning and memory, she is a Professor of Cell & Systems Biology and previously served as Dean of the Faculty of Arts & Science, the university’s largest faculty. She holds a PhD in neuroscience from the University of Calgary.
